"Lecture Held by Inviting Industry Experts to Strengthen Job Expertise"

Hanwha Construction Enhances Developer Capabilities of Employees View original image


[Asia Economy Reporter Onyu Lim] Hanwha Construction conducted developer training for its employees to strengthen job expertise.


Hanwha Construction announced on the 13th that it held the 'H-Developer Session' on the 10th at the Seoul Federation of Korean Industries Building, inviting experts from the housing and construction industries to give lectures to its employees.


The H-Developer Session was conducted to enhance the job expertise and work capabilities of employees. About 100 Hanwha Construction employees attended the lecture. The lectures were given by Jin-ho Choi, Director of comprehensive real estate development company Pides Development, and Sang-woo Lee, CEO of Exponential, a real estate expert.


Director Choi gave a lecture on the topic of 'Residential Space Trends 2020?2021.' He introduced seven major trends including the concepts of ▲Super & Hyper Phenomena ▲We Do ▲All in Room.


Director Choi explained, "With the Fourth Industrial Revolution, spaces characterized by hyper-connectivity, super-intelligence, and ultra-convergence that transcend existing spatial paradigms will increase, and the sharing economy will be applied to spaces, allowing people with similar hobbies and tastes to share spaces."


CEO Lee gave a lecture on the topic of '2019 Real Estate Market Review and 2020 Real Estate Market Outlook.' He analyzed various statistics, legal and institutional changes, and explained the changes expected in this year's real estate market.



A Hanwha Construction official stated, "This year, we plan to further expand complex development and self-development projects and carry out development projects centered on key hubs in the metropolitan area and major cities," adding, "In line with this, we will continue to provide education to strengthen the developer capabilities of our employees."
